What are business process management systems used for?

A business process management system is a collection of tools that helps companies in the automatization of processes. A business process management system should allow modeling, development, editing, and run the company’s business processes, as well as gathering data and analytics. It is a must for companies who wish to maximize efficiency by enhancing business process management and connecting individuals, procedures, and information systems into easily controlled applications to enhance business operations. Business process management systems are used for:- 1. To improve efficiency:- BPMS can simultaneously monitor multiple projects and processes, creating the opportunity to provide near-real-time management of an organization’s resources. It also enables organizations to reduce redundancy in data collection and analysis, which is a waste of valuable resources and time. 2. To reduce cost:- Automating key processes can help organizations reduce operational costs. Additionally, business process management systems can help organizations automate tasks such as invoicing and claims processing. 3. To improve customer satisfaction:- A business process management system (BPMS) can improve customer satisfaction by automating and streamlining processes, thus reducing the chance of errors. Provide customers with real-time status updates on their orders or requests, which can improve communication and transparency. 4. To improve communication within an organization:- Improve communication and collaboration within employees, departments, and other entities. This can help to ensure that communication is timely and accurate, and that information is shared effectively between different departments and individuals. 5. To improve the quality of products and services:- It can help to ensure that processes are carried out consistently and accurately. This can help to reduce errors and improve quality. Track and monitor process performance, making it easier to identify areas where quality improvements can be made. What does the company Six Sigma Program do?

There is no company called Six Sigma Program, instead Six Sigma is a set of tools used by business and others that improves process outputs by identifying and removing error and reducing variability in manufacturing and business processes.

What are Six Sigma tools commonly used for?

The Six Sigma tools are commonly used to gather and provide information. They are used in the monitoring and control of process performance. They can also be used to identify and predict fluctuations.
